STAR DUSTER
STAR DUSTER is a Texas gas lease in Nacogdoches County, Railroad Commission district 06, operated by Sonerra Resources Corporation.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from December 2006 to August 2026, totalling 969,425 thousand cubic feet.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$351K, with roughly $75K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 2,648 thousand cubic feet a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was August 2025, at 6,596 thousand cubic feet.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 17%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

- How much is STAR DUSTER worth?
- The remaining production from STAR DUSTER is estimated to be worth about $351K in total as of 27 August 2026, within a range of $292K to $411K.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in STAR DUSTER is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production STAR DUSTER has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for STAR DUSTER is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
